Output 06b8f95a27d7899b182af22243c9aad3e5451fb31fe1efa078238bfc33727cf6:0

value
5246142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c11d98be98c3fdd4e20ee571d6039a6eb4cea81c OP_EQUAL
address
3KJ7nyjFSwdnMq6rb8RCbEkqkEx23n6D2V
transaction
06b8f95a27d7899b182af22243c9aad3e5451fb31fe1efa078238bfc33727cf6
confirmations
289532
spent
true